   /**Returns an arraylist of the items in the list from head of list to tail of list

   * @return an arraylist of the items in the list

   */

   public ArrayList<T> toArrayList() {

       ArrayList<T> list = new ArrayList<T>();

       Node<T> current = head;

       while(current != null)

       {

           list.add(current.getData());

           System.out.println(current.getData());

           current = current.getNext();      

       }

       return list;

   }
